John Stape returns to teaching?
If the spoiler in today's Sun is true, then John Stape tries to get back into his old career of being a teacher. Hasn't he learned his lessons already after kidnapping one of his pupils? The paper says that John knows that he can't be a teacher with his criminal record so he applies for, and gets a job at an adult education centre. Fiz, as you can imagine, is not best pleased.
